Environment
The sum of all external conditions and influences affecting the life and development of an organism or population.
Cognitive Development
A field of study in neuroscience and psychology focusing on a child's development in terms of information processing, conceptual resources, perceptual skill, language learning, and other aspects of brain development.
Preoperational
The stage in Piaget's theory of cognitive development where children begin to engage in symbolic play but lack the ability to perform operations or use logical thinking.
Accommodation
In psychology, it refers to the cognitive process of revising existing cognitive schemas, perceptions, and understandings to make new information fit.
